CRA-Z-ART Announces Licensing Deal For "BeatMoovz"
A hot, new Japanese invention that plays music as you move

RANDOLPH, N.J., Feb. 18,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Cra-Z-Art®, a prime manufacturer and leader in trendy toy, art and stationery products, announced today at the North American International Toy Fair in New York City a strategic licensing agreement with Japan-based Dmet Properties to market and distribute BeatMoovz™ in the U.S. The item is a new musical electronic device that appeals to many age groups, from kids to young adults.

BeatMoovz is motion-activated and plays music and special effects sounds as you move. The product comes with two special wristbands that users wear to enable the device. Consumers can experience the excitement, via an app and Bluetooth technology, by moving, dancing, and creating unique musical beats. It's the next musical sensation of the new age!

BeatMoovz is expected to be available at major retailers in August. Global patent is pending.
